Alta Bistro4319 Main Street, #104, Whistler
My New Favorite
Submitted Saturday, May 5, 2012 - 7:53am [Dine in]

My wife and I dropped in without reservations. They found us a table immediately. My wife order the $25 menu and I ordered the $35. She had the Spring Salad, Goat Cheese and Buttermilk Mousse, and the Pork Cheeks. I enjoyed the Chicken Terrine, Pacific Cod and Mussels. My entrée was the Duck Breasts. The servers took the time to explain to me what Buttermilk Mousse was as well as where Pork Cheeks come from. I also learned that Chicken Terrine is a paste rather than a chicken part.

Everything was served elegantly and it was all delicious. The attention to little details was amazing. Alta Bistro is my new favorite Whistler restaurant.

I will be back to impress my gourmet chef friends who think I am a total hick when it comes to dining.

White Spot4005 Whistler Way, Whistler
Great Hamburgers, Server went MIA
Submitted Wednesday, November 2, 2011 - 7:05am [Dine in]

First I have to mention that I started with low expections. All I wanted was a big juicy hamburger and fries.The food met my pre-lowered expectations. The service, however, failed to meet my expectations.

My advice to fellow diners is to order (2) drinks, (2) fries and extra condiments when you place your initial order -- for this will be the last time you will ever see your server. I don't know where she went, but we had to finish our hamburger without a drink refill and no extra sauce for our fries. I saw other servers walk by our table, but our server totally disappeared. My wife and I felt a bet abused and victimized.

Dear Mr. Spot, If you are going to run a "McDonald's like" burger joint, please lower your prices and add a drink dispenser so that I can have refills when I need them. A front counter for easy ordering would be recommended. You can save money on servers and cooks and just buy everything prepackaged. You have a great location. It is shame to see you squander good real estate. Just a thought...

Araxi Restaurant + Bar4222 Village Square, Whistler
What a Deal -5 courses for $30
Submitted Friday, October 28, 2011 - 1:18am [Dine in]

What a deal! Had the 5 courses for $30 offer and it was delicous. We had 8 people in our party and they all ordered different combinations of the 5 course deal. I had the duck which was fantastic. Another ordered the steak and we all felt it was the best steak ever. Desserts were wonderful.

The wine list looked very complete. Ordered two types of wines that were perfectly paired with the food.

Everyone was very impressed and are looking forward to our next Whistler visit.
